admin管理员组

文章数量:1530928

2024年1月7日发(作者:)

如何入门编程

编程是现代社会中一项重要的技能,在各个行业都有广泛的应用。掌握编程能力可以为个人的职业发展和学术研究提供巨大的机遇。那么,如何入门编程呢?本文将从以下几个方面给出一些建议。

一、明确学习目标和动机

在学习编程之前,首先要明确学习的目标和动机。编程领域非常广泛,包含多种不同的编程语言和技术。对于初学者来说,可以根据自己的兴趣和需求选择一个合适的编程语言作为入门。

例如,如果想要开发网站或者进行数据分析,可以选择学习Python;如果对移动应用开发感兴趣,可以学习Java或者Swift。明确学习目标和动机有助于更好地进行学习规划和持续学习。

二、选择合适的学习资源

在学习编程过程中,选择合适的学习资源是很重要的。有许多免费和付费的在线学习平台和教程可以选择。以下是一些常见的学习资源推荐:

1. 在线课程平台:像Coursera、edX和Udemy等平台上有许多编程相关的课程,可以根据自己的需求选择合适的课程。

2. 编程书籍:有很多经典的编程书籍,比如《C程序设计语言》、《Python编程从入门到实践》等,可以从基础到进阶进行学习。

3. 编程社区和论坛:像Stack Overflow、GitHub等编程社区可以帮助你解决学习和实践中遇到的问题,还可以与其他编程爱好者交流经验。

4. 在线编程练习:LeetCode、HackerRank等在线编程练习平台可以帮助你提高编程能力,更好地理解和应用所学知识。

三、掌握基础知识和编程概念

学习编程需要掌握一些基础知识和编程概念。以下是一些常见的基础知识和编程概念:

1. 数据类型和变量:了解不同的数据类型(如整数、浮点数、字符串等)以及如何定义和使用变量。

2. 条件语句和循环:掌握条件语句(如if-else语句)和循环语句(如for循环、while循环),可以实现程序的逻辑判断和重复执行。

3. 函数和模块:学习如何定义和调用函数,以及如何使用模块来组织和复用代码。

4. 数据结构和算法:了解常见的数据结构(如数组、链表、栈、队列等)和基本的算法(如排序、查找等),可以解决实际问题。

四、动手实践和项目实战

学习编程不仅仅是理解概念和知识,更重要的是进行实践和项目实战。通过动手实践可以巩固所学知识,并且更好地理解编程思维和解决问题的能力。

可以从简单的练习开始,逐步挑战更复杂的项目。例如,可以尝试编写一个简单的计算器程序、制作一个简单的网页或者开发一个小型的游戏。在实践过程中,会遇到各种问题,不要气馁,通过搜索和探索解决问题的方法。

五、与人互动和参与开源社区

学习编程是一个持续不断的过程,可以通过与其他人互动和参与开源社区来加快学习进度。可以加入相关的学习群组或者参加编程交流活动,与其他编程爱好者分享经验和学习资源。

同时,了解和参与开源项目也可以提高编程能力,开源项目有助于学习优秀的代码实践和项目开发经验。

六、不断学习和实践改进

学习编程是一个不断学习和实践改进的过程。要保持持续的学习动力和学习兴趣,关注最新的编程技术和发展趋势。

同时,要注重实践和项目经验的积累,不断反思和改进自己的编程能力。可以参与到真实的项目中,与其他开发人员协作,提高自己的编码水平和项目管理能力。

总结起来,如何入门编程需要明确学习目标和动机,选择合适的学习资源,掌握基础知识和编程概念,进行动手实践和项目实战,与人互动和参与开源社区,不断学习和实践改进。希望以上的建议对初学者能够有所帮助,祝愿大家在编程学习的道路上取得成功!

本文标签: 学习编程实践